Job Details
The Sentinel Support Analyst will support, administer, troubleshoot, repair, and escalate customer issues across a wide line of technologies with a security focus. Excellent written and verbal communication skills are needed to assist customers and ensure that changes are performed with security as the prevailing measure.
Responsibilities:
- Manage incidents and requests within the established SLA.
- Vendor and service provider case management.
- Stay up to date on the latest security intelligence.
- Perform health checks for various security products.
Qualifications:
- Experience with at least three of the following security technologies:
- Cisco Security Products (CSE, Umbrella, Secure Network Analytics, DUO)
- Various EDR Platforms (Cylance, CrowdStrike, Defender, SentinelOne)
- Illumio Zero Trust
- Tenable Products (IO, SC, Lumin)
- Horizon 3 Node Zero
- Email Security Products (Proofpoint, Mimecast, Cisco Secure Email)
- Darktrace
- Understanding of network protocols and traffic flow.
- Ability to perform security whitelisting of false-positives and evaluate security requests.
- Knowledge of Domain Name System (DNS) technologies.
- Experience with Virtualization Technologies (VMware, Hyper-V) is a plus.
- Strong verbal and written communication skills.
- Knowledge of IT security trends, vulnerabilities, and news.
- Basic knowledge of Linux is a plus.
